WebJul 2, 2024 · Hostas are easy to grow, and they are adaptable. Spring is the best time to plant them, but you can plant into the summer as long as you keep them well-watered. Try to plant on a cloudy day because it eases transplant shock. If you do plan on planting late in the summer, give the plants enough time to establish their roots before the cold weather. WebOct 12, 2024 · Plant Zone: 4 to 9. Muscari, sometimes called grape hyacinth, is a lovely hosta companion. It is a fall planted bulb that can be planted in and amongst the hostas. Then in the early spring they will pop up and bloom before the hosta leaves come out.

WebThe best time to plant hostas in Michigan is during the spring and fall months when the temperatures are moderate and the soil is moist. Ideally, you should aim to plant them in April or May, as well as September or October. Cut the plant down to the ground. The leaves and stems of hostas can be easily cut with garden shears or a sharp pair of scissors. Cut the plant down to the ground. You may want to leave an inch or two of plant to mark where it is in the garden. 3. Mulch to insulate the hostas. WebDec 26, 2024 · Hostas are popular shade-loving perennials cultivated by gardeners for their easy care and sustainability in a variety of garden soils. Hostas are easily recognized by their multitude of attractive foliage and upright flower stems, which bear lavender blooms during the summer months. WebJun 24, 2024 · Watering hostas in the morning will help keep them hydrated during hotter parts of the day during the summer. You can sprinkle mulch around the bases of the hostas to help keep the soil moist. WebFeb 2, 2024 · The highlight of this perennial plant is its variety of leaves. Unlike many other plants, the leaves of the hosta can provide just as much of a visual show as any flower. SFGate points out that you can find hostas with green leaves and yellow or white edges, and others with variegated colors that can include gold, blue-green, and gray-blue. WebApr 11, 2024 · 1. Don Juan rose. The Don Juan rose is a popular climbing rose with velvety red flowers. This cultivar is classified by the American Rose Society (ARS) as a large-flowered climber (LCl). Introduced by J&P in the 1950s, ‘Don Juan’ has an unmistakable dark red hue, with up to 40 petals per flower and an intense rose fragrance.

Dahlias prefer full sun and well … salem methodist church halifaxWebJul 31, 2024 · Look for a granular fertilizer with equal amounts of nitrogen, phosphorous and potassium in the range of 5-5-5 to 10-10-10. This will give your plants a steady supply of nutrients at all times.
